Abstract
We have investigated the dynamics of color center formation (darkening ) in a 1000 ppm thulium-doped ZBLAN (ZrF4-BaF2-LaF3-AlF3-NaF) optical fiber by ultraviolet (285, 300, 351, 364 nm) and infrared(1112 nm) exp osures. We observe that color centers are simultaneously created and p hotobleached by the UV light and that upon exposure to 1112 nm the col or centers are thermally activated. We make the hypothesis that the me chanism responsible for the formation of color centers is a charge tra nsfer to trap sites following the ionization of the glass matrix by an excitation from the 5d level of the thulium ion by similar to 55 000 cm(-1). Also, thermal annealing of the color centers is investigated w ith the use of a standard stretched-exponential model. The annealing r esults are consistent with the assumption of a distribution of energie s of color center states. (C) 1998 Elsevier Science B.V. All rights re served.
